IT

Paul Sumption and Paul Barrow

The IT facility plans, develops, maintains and manages the whole IT infrastructure for the staff located at the Centre for Stem Cell Research as well as some servers and services located at some other Stem Cell Institute sites. In addition they are responsible for the migration and planning of the IT infrastructure when the Stem Cell Institute relocates to its new building in 2017. Services:  Hosting and running websites for the Bioinformatics service  Bioinformatic server management and installation / advice on Bioinformatic packages  Hardware and software purchases  Development and day to day maintenance of the IT systems used within the CSCR building  General computer support and advice to the research, teaching and administrative occupants of the CSCR building  Liaising with the University Computing Service concerning support and security issues to ensure the security and correct use of up to 400 computing resources  Monitoring and improving network performance and security  Co-ordinating and liaising with other IT staff that are part of the SCI  VoIP phone system  Wireless access  Managed printing and data storage  Offsite data storage and server replication in liaison with the Clinical School Computing Service The IT team have a help desk system, the core hours for this are 9am - 4.30pm. Users submit a support request and are issued a 'ticket' which then tracks progress on their request.
